STATE v. SIRECI

No. 70937.

536 So.2d 231 (1988)

STATE of Florida, Appellant/Cross-Appellee, v. Henry Perry SIRECI, Appellee/Cross-Appellant.

Supreme Court of Florida.

December 22, 1988.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Robert A. Butterworth, Atty. Gen., and Margene A. Roper, Asst. Atty. Gen., Daytona Beach, for appellant/cross-appellee.

Mark E. Olive, Tallahassee, and Richard H. Burr, III, New York City, for appellee/cross-appellant.


PER CURIAM.

The state appeals from an order granting Henry Perry Sireci a new death penalty sentencing hearing. We have jurisdiction pursuant to article V, section 3(b)(1) of the Florida Constitution.

Sireci was convicted of and sentenced to death for the first-degree murder of Howard Poteet, the owner of a used car lot. Sireci went to the car lot to take some keys to a car so he could come back later and steal it. A struggle ensued, and Poteet was killed...
